Resource Description
-
Luminex IS100 multiplex ELISA services use both polystyrene (non-magnetic) and magnetic bead based kits. Kits are available for human, canine, mouse, rat, non-human primate, pig, horse, and monkey.
"This system uses cell-sorting technology to measure multiple proteins simultaneously. This technology will be of great use for investigators studying transgenic mice, where sample volumes are low. In addition, the multiplex platform allows for screening of human cohorts in disease research particularly of small volume in repeated sampling protocols."
